Definition of Sarcosine Based Amino Acid Surfactant Market:
The Sarcosine Based Amino Acid Surfactant Market encompasses the production, distribution, and sale of surfactants derived from sarcosine, an amino acid. These surfactants are characterized by their mildness, biodegradability, and excellent foaming and cleansing properties. They are used in a wide range of applications across various industries, including personal care, detergents, pharmaceuticals, and industrial cleaning.
Key components of this market include the raw materials used to produce sarcosine, the manufacturing processes for converting sarcosine into surfactants (such as acyl sarcosinates and sarcosine salts), the formulation and blending of these surfactants into final products, and the distribution channels that bring these products to end-users. The market also includes services such as research and development, technical support, and regulatory compliance.
Key terms related to this market include:
Sarcosine: An N-methylglycine amino acid that serves as the base molecule for these surfactants.
Acyl Sarcosinates: Surfactants formed by reacting sarcosine with fatty acids, offering excellent foaming and emulsifying properties.
Sarcosine Salts: Salts of sarcosine, such as sodium sarcosinate, used as mild cleansers and foam boosters.
Biodegradability: The ability of a substance to be broken down by microorganisms in the environment.
Critical Micelle Concentration (CMC): The concentration above which surfactant molecules form micelles in solution, influencing their cleaning and foaming efficiency.

Market Segmentation
The Sarcosine Based Amino Acid Surfactant Market can be segmented based on several key factors: type, application, and end-user. Understanding these segments provides a comprehensive view of the market dynamics and growth opportunities.
By Type:
Acyl Sarcosinates: These are formed by reacting sarcosine with fatty acids, resulting in surfactants with excellent foaming, emulsifying, and cleansing properties. They are widely used in personal care products, such as shampoos and body washes, due to their mildness and ability to create rich, stable foams.
Sarcosine Salts (e.g., Sodium Sarcosinate): These salts are derived from sarcosine and are known for their mildness and ability to boost the foaming properties of other surfactants. They are often used in cleansers and detergents to improve their cleaning performance while minimizing irritation.
Others: This category includes other derivatives and formulations of sarcosine, which may be tailored for specific applications or performance characteristics.
By Application:
Personal Care: This is the largest application segment, encompassing products such as shampoos, body washes, facial cleansers, and hand soaps. Sarcosine-based surfactants are favored in these products due to their mildness, biodegradability, and ability to provide effective cleansing without causing irritation.
Detergents: This segment includes dishwashing liquids, laundry detergents, and other cleaning agents. Sarcosine-based surfactants are used to enhance cleaning performance, improve foaming, and reduce environmental impact compared to traditional surfactants.
Pharmaceuticals: Sarcosine-based surfactants are used in certain pharmaceutical formulations due to their biocompatibility and low toxicity. They can act as solubilizers, emulsifiers, and wetting agents in these applications.
Industrial Cleaning: This segment includes industrial cleaning agents used in manufacturing, food processing, and other industries. Sarcosine-based surfactants can provide effective cleaning performance in these applications while being more environmentally friendly than conventional cleaning agents.

Sarcosine Based Amino Acid Surfactant Market Key Technology Landscape:
The Sarcosine Based Amino Acid Surfactant Market relies on several key technologies for the production, formulation, and application of these surfactants. These technologies drive efficiency, sustainability, and performance improvements across the value chain.
One crucial area is chemical synthesis, which involves the production of sarcosine and its derivatives. Advancements in chemical synthesis techniques, such as enzymatic catalysis and green chemistry approaches, are enabling more sustainable and cost-effective production methods. These technologies can reduce the use of hazardous chemicals, lower energy consumption, and minimize waste generation. Another key technology is formulation science, which focuses on developing innovative formulations that optimize the performance and stability of sarcosine-based surfactants in various applications. This involves understanding the interactions between surfactants, solvents, and other ingredients to create products with desired properties, such as foaming, cleansing, and emulsifying capabilities. Analytical techniques, such as chromatography and spectroscopy, are used to characterize the composition and properties of sarcosine-based surfactants. These techniques are essential for quality control, process optimization, and ensuring compliance with regulatory standards.
Furthermore, nanotechnology plays a growing role in the market. Nanomaterials can be used to enhance the delivery and performance of sarcosine-based surfactants, for example, by encapsulating them in nanocarriers to improve their stability and bioavailability.
